These are the 6 movies in the line-up:


Good Will Running:


Runtime: 17 minutes

Directed by: Rudi Gremels

Produced by: Rudi Gremels

Language: English

Country of origin: South Africa

William is a Malawian living in a township in South Africa. Making ends meet is his sole goal, all the while sending money back home to his family. Along this journey, his employer and ultra-trail runner catalyses his fitness career. William builds up his endurance by cycling, and eventually running, to work. It becomes his mission to train for and win the UTCT - a coveted trail-running race in Cape Town. Parallel to his newfound passion for running is William's blooming curiosity and love for nature, inspired by his work for a non-profit organisation. William's beautiful perspectives weave a hopeful and optimistic worldview of our innate interconnectedness - both with nature, and fellow humans, on the trails.


JUNKO:


Runtime: 8 minutes

Directed by: Matt Trappe

Produced by: Auteur Sportif

Language: English

Country of origin: USA

After a lonely move from Japan and two bouts with cancer, ultrarunner Junko Kazukawa decided life was short so she ran the Leadville 100. Along the way she found the one thing she had been looking for all along.


LES SOMMETS LIBRES:


Runtime: 31 minutes

Directed by: Benjamin Nieto

Produced by: Jerome Benadiner

Language: French (English Subtitles)

Country of origin: France

Les sommets libres is a documentary that traces the inspiring journey of Ulrich N'Djinke. This child from La Jonchère, a sensitive neighborhood in Annecy (Haute-Savoie), facing the Alps, who has always been fascinated by the mountains, dared to venture into this environment that was not his own by independently starting outdoor sports, particularly trail running. Now an educator and sports coach, this 34-year-old Franco-Cameroonian has since been dedicated to involving young people from the neighborhoods, encouraging them to take ownership of a world whose history has, until now, always been written without them.


MO ON THE GO:


Runtime: 17 minutes

Directed by: Anthony Cloutier & Nicolas Mithieuxl

Produced by: N3 Production Inc

Language: English

Country of origin: Canada

Meet Morgan Leroy, an ultra trail runner from Ladysmith, British Columbia. Through her family and her life's challenges, she tells us why ultra is her joy, her pain, her outlet. She gives us a poignant testimony about life, our relationship to the world and to others.

PICAPICA:


Runtime: 17 minutes

Directed by: Justin Galant

Produced by: Justin Galant Creative Production

Language: French (English subtitles)

Country of origin: France

For several months now, Martin has been taking part in a series of high-profile races in the hope of achieving the kind of success he achieved in 2021 with his great victory in the Mont Blanc 90km. Injury after disappointment, he became trapped in a negative cycle that many top athletes experience. This summer, encouraged by his friend and race organiser, Martin is taking part in the ultra-distance Challenge de Montcalm in Ariège: La PICaPICA. A hotbed of trail running, love of the mountains and passion for trail running, Martin started out here several years ago. Finally, he's back, ready to take on this extraordinary race, 109km and 11500m+, with the aim of rediscovering his passion for the mountains.

TALK TO FRANK:


Runtime: 5 minutes

Directed by: Matt Green

Produced by: Summit Fever Media

Language: English

Country of origin: England

My name is Frank, and I'm a cocker spaniel from Manchester. My story began when I moved in with Maleek, my human. He wasn't in a great place—having just finished a four-year sentence, he found himself transitioning from one prison to another: the COVID lockdown and a debilitating depression. I gave him no choice; he had to start walking me. One walk led to another, and soon we were running. Before he knew it, we were on our way up Pen Y Ghent, his first mountain. The mountains are his spiritual home, he needs them just as much as I do. His ambition is to run in the Alps. To push his boundaries and tackle a route higher and further than he has ever been before. So that's our plan. Together we are going to go to the Alps, we're going to see the peaks, the ridges, the summits, and we're going to heal together.
